Rant for celebrating Down Syndrome Awareness Month

A rant to celebrate Down Syndrome Awareness Month: “Raising a child with Down Syndrome.”

From discovering in the womb that your child will more than likely have Down Syndrome. Doctors educate you about the multiple health and mental issues. To a downright doctor advising to terminate pregnancy. The anguished decision to keep child. To the instant love at birth, and think what a great choice you have made.

The monthlong hospital stay on the Mainland for the heart issue most Down Syndrome babies are born with. Forgetting all the horror and tears of the hospital stay because you love your baby so much. The rushes to the emergency room washed away when your baby becomes a child that perfectly loving soul.

Come to present some six years later and your baby has become the school rock star where little classmates line up to kiss him for his birthday. Who shows no ego when getting busted doing the wrong thing and instantly apologizes for his or her actions. Your special child who touches so many souls every day, as you wonder am I the one with “special needs”? The child quick to hug and peck you on the cheek and you feel it down to your heels. Or something like that.

He’s 12 now.

Andrew Bayron

Kahului
